10 Essential IT Support Tips for Businesses

In today’s digital age, having a reliable IT support system is crucial for businesses to thrive. Whether IT’s ensuring smooth operations or safeguarding sensitive data, an efficient IT support team can make all the difference. However, managing IT support can be a daunting task, especially for smaller businesses. To help you navigate this complex landscape, we have compiled a comprehensive list of 10 essential IT support tips for businesses.

  1. Invest in proactive monitoring and maintenance: Preventing IT issues before they occur is far more cost-effective and less disruptive than dealing with them after they arise. By investing in proactive monitoring and maintenance, you can identify potential problems and address them before they impact your business.
  2. Establish data backup and recovery protocols: Data loss can have catastrophic consequences for businesses. Implement a robust data backup and recovery system to protect your valuable information in case of unexpected events such as hardware failure, cyber-attacks or natural disasters.
  3. Implement strong cybersecurity measures: Cyber threats continue to evolve, making IT essential to implement strong cybersecurity measures to safeguard your network and data. This includes using firewalls, antivirus software, encryption, and regularly updating your software to patch any vulnerabilities.
  4. Train employees on cybersecurity best practices: Your employees play a critical role in maintaining cybersecurity. Ensure they are trained in best practices such as not clicking on suspicious links or attachments, using strong passwords, and being cautious while accessing sensitive information.
  5. Have a disaster recovery plan in place: Despite your best efforts, unforeseen events can still occur. Having a comprehensive disaster recovery plan in place ensures that you can swiftly recover your IT systems and resume operations without significant downtime.
  6. Regularly update software and hardware: Outdated software and hardware can expose your business to security risks and hinder productivity. Regularly update your systems, applications, and devices to benefit from the latest features, bug fixes, and security patches.
  7. Utilize remote IT support: With the rise of remote work, having remote IT support has become even more essential. Remote support allows your IT team to resolve issues quickly, regardless of the location, saving time and reducing costs associated with on-site visits.
  8. Monitor network performance and traffic: Understanding your network’s performance and traffic patterns can help identify potential bottlenecks or security breaches. Using network monitoring tools, analyze performance metrics, track bandwidth usage, and monitor for any suspicious activities.
  9. Establish a help desk system: A help desk system allows employees to report IT issues and track their resolution status. IT streamlines the IT support process, ensures accountability, and improves customer satisfaction by providing transparency and effective communication.
  10. Regularly review and optimize IT processes: technology is ever-evolving, so IT’s crucial to review and optimize your IT processes regularly. Identify areas where efficiency can be improved, automate repetitive tasks, and adapt your IT strategy to meet the changing demands of your business.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: How often should I update my software and hardware?

A: IT is recommended to update your software and hardware as soon as updates are released. Delaying updates can leave your systems vulnerable to security breaches or compatibility issues.

Q: How do I train employees on cybersecurity best practices?

A: Conduct regular cybersecurity awareness training sessions for employees, covering topics such as identifying phishing emails, creating strong passwords, and using secure internet connections.

Q: What should a disaster recovery plan include?

A: A disaster recovery plan should include a comprehensive inventory of critical systems and assets, backup and recovery procedures, contact information for key personnel, and a detailed plan for restoring operations.

Q: Why is proactive IT support important?

A: Proactive IT support helps prevent issues before they disrupt your business. IT minimizes downtime, reduces costs associated with reactive troubleshooting, and improves productivity.

Q: What are some commonly used network monitoring tools?

A: Some popular network monitoring tools include Nagios, PRTG Network Monitor, SolarWinds Network Performance Monitor, and Zabbix.
